  2. Oakland School for the Arts (OSA) is a visual and performing arts charter school in Oakland, California, United States. OSA opened in 2002 with a curriculum that integrated college preparatory academics with conservatory-style arts training.

  3. Oakland School for the Arts (OSA) is a nonprofit public charter school founded by Governor Jerry Brown – then Oakland’s Mayor – in 2002. Now in its 20th year, OSA serves over 800 students in grades 6-12 tuition-free. OSA is housed in Uptown Oakland’s historic Fox Theater and Newberry Building.

  4. Students concentrate on one area of art – Audio Production & Engineering, Dance, Fashion Design, Instrumental Music, Literary Arts, Media Arts, Production Design, Theatre, Vocal Music or Visual Art. Small classes allow for individual attention and personal training.
